Lessons from the Garden: The Fall of Adam and Eve
This week on From the Housetops, Brother Matthew reflects on the fall of Adam and Eve in the Garden of Eden. Tempted by the serpent, Eve questioned God’s command and allowed doubt to take root. She ate the forbidden fruit and gave it to Adam, who also chose disobedience. In that moment, innocence was lost, sin entered the world, and their bond with God was broken. Shame and fear replaced their once-perfect harmony with Him.
Yet even in judgment, God’s mercy remained. Though divine justice demanded consequences, the promise of redemption was set in motion. This episode explores the weight of their choice, the dangers of pride, and the call to trust in God’s love and faithfulness.
